Upper Gastrointestinal Crohn's Disease: Literature Review and Case Presentation

Upper gastrointestinal Crohn's Disease (CD) can be hard to diagnose, often presenting only as iron-deficiency anemia. Early suspicion and advanced diagnostics like fecal calprotectin testing are key for timely management.
Area of Science:
- Gastroenterology
- Internal Medicine
- Inflammatory Bowel Disease Research
Background:
- Upper gastrointestinal tract predominant Crohn's Disease (CD) presents with vague symptoms, delaying diagnosis and management.
- Standard diagnostic evaluations for inflammatory bowel disease (IBD) may be inconclusive in these cases.
Observation:
- An 18-year-old male presented with unexplained, persistent iron-deficiency anemia.
- Initial extensive testing, including multiple endoscopies with biopsies, was unrevealing.
- Elevated fecal calprotectin prompted advanced enteroscopy with endoscopic mucosal resection (EMR).
Findings:
- EMR revealed characteristic CD findings: cobblestoned mucosa, focal crypt abscesses, and chronic inflammation.
- Histopathology confirmed CD, despite initially normal endoscopic findings.
Implications:
- Highlights the importance of suspecting CD in patients with unexplained iron-deficiency anemia.
- Emphasizes the utility of fecal calprotectin in prompting further investigation for IBD.
- Underscores the need for persistent, advanced diagnostic workup, including serial endoscopy and EMR, for upper GI predominant CD.
Abstract:
Upper gastrointestinal tract predominant Crohn's Disease (CD) remains an elusive clinical entity, manifesting limited or vague symptomatology, eluding clinical suspicion, and delaying subsequent diagnostic evaluation. As a result, it has not been widely described and there is a lack of clear recommendations for diagnosis or management. Standard IBD evaluation including serologic testing, imaging, and endoscopy may initially not be fruitful. Furthermore, endoscopic evaluation may be grossly normal in patients without long standing-disease. We describe an 18-year-old male who presented with only unexplained, persistent iron-deficiency anemia. Extensive outpatient testing including multiple endoscopic evaluations with standard biopsies was unfruitful. Ultimately, a positive fecal calprotectin prompted enteroscopy with endoscopic mucosal resection (EMR) in an effort to obtain a larger, deeper tissue specimen. Grossly cobblestoned mucosa along with histopathology revealing focal crypt abscesses, chronic inflammation in the lamina propria, and superficial foveolar epithelial regenerative changes were consistent with CD. This patient's case illustrates the need for a high degree of suspicion for CD in patients with unexplained or persistent iron deficiency anemias. Persistent investigation yielded an elevation in fecal calprotectin suggesting underlying gastrointestinal inflammation and prompted advanced endoscopic evaluation with EMR. Waxing and waning tissue findings are characteristic of CD and pose a unique challenge in patients with upper gastrointestinal predominant pathology. As such, diligent workup including laboratory evaluation, imaging, and serial endoscopy is critical to establish pathology and dictate subsequent management in IBD, especially upper gastrointestinal tract predominant CD.
